Full Stack Engineer

  • Hybrid
  • English
  • Banking
  • Regular
  • Agile/Scrum
Add to Job Cart RECOMMEND A CANDIDATE

Join us, and enhance payment processes with powerful mainframe expertise!

Krakow-based opportunity with the possibility to work 80% remotely!

As a Full Stack Engineer, you will be working for our client, a leading financial institution, on a transformative project focused on modernizing their core banking systems. This initiative involves developing and supporting both back-end and front-end services for processing payments, including SEPA, SWIFT messages, and internal entries. You will play a crucial role in enhancing the infrastructure with Java, Spring Boot, and ReactJS, while implementing modern integration techniques and automation testing to optimize and streamline their payment systems.

Your main responsibilities:

  • Developing and maintaining services using Java with Spring Boot
  • Supporting and enhancing back-end and front-end applications for payments processing
  • Managing payment services portfolio on cloud and on-premises hosting
  • Building and maintaining service-related interfaces with APIs or microservices patterns
  • Utilizing tools like Git, GitHub, Jenkins, Maven, and Nexus for artifact management
  • Following Agile and DevOps methodologies with tools such as Jira, Confluence, and SharePoint
  • Collaborating with Business Analysts and Project/Product Managers to convert business requirements into development sprints
  • Implementing automation testing frameworks to reduce costs and improve efficiency
  • Increasing Straight-Through-Processing (STP) capabilities of services
  • Adopting modern integration approaches using APIs, MuleSoft, Kafka, and microservices patterns

You’re ideal for this role if you have:

  • Proficiency in Java 8+, with experience in Java 17+ preferred
  • Knowledge of Spring and Spring Boot frameworks
  • Strong understanding of database technologies and SQL, with Oracle preferred
  • Experience with ReSTful microservices and APIs
  • Familiarity with Git, GitHub, Jenkins, Maven, and other artifact management tools
  • Experience in a DevOps delivery team
  • Understanding of HTTP web technologies and JavaScript, with React preferred
  • Experience in Agile and DevOps methodologies

It is a strong plus if you have:

  • Experience with modern integration tools and patterns such as MuleSoft, Kafka, and microservices
  • Exposure to automation testing frameworks and techniques
  • Familiarity with cloud and on-premises hosting environments

#GETREADY  to meet with us!

We would like to meet you. If you are interested please apply and attach your CV in English or Polish, including a statement that you agree to our processing and storing of your personal data. You can always also apply by sending us an email at recruitment@itds.pl.

Internal number #5790

Benefits

Access to +100 projects
Access to Healthcare
fintech-delivery
Access to Multisport
Training platforms
Access to Pluralsight
Make your CV shine
B2B or Permanent Contract
Flexible & remote work
Flexible hours and remote work

Apply for this job now

    I agree to receive marketing information from ITDS Polska to the e-mail address provided
    We need your consent for recruitment processes for selected jobs. Please include a consent for data processing in your CV or send a statement of consent to privacy@itds.pl. You may also grant consent to future recruitment processes for similar jobs.